Even though Wraysbury Station might not have the hustle and bustle of a city terminal, it offers all the essentials to ensure a smooth journey. While there is no staffed ticket office, ticket machines are conveniently available, making it easy to collect your tickets. Additionally, these machines are accessible and equipped to handle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ring that all travelers can navigate the station with ease.
For assistance, the station has help points rather than staffed desks, and there's CCTV for added security. The station offers step-free access from separate entrances, with a reasonably accessible route between platforms, making it more navigable for those with mobility aids.
There are no waiting rooms or refreshment facilities available, so you might want to plan ahead to bring your snacks or grab a coffee before heading to the station. Bicycle enthusiasts will find rack spaces on Platform 1 and rest assured, your bike will be safe under the watchful eyes of the station’s CCTV.
Wraysbury Station’s connections with other modes of transport enhance its convenience for travelers. Although there is no direct taxi service or bicycle hire facilities, the station is well-served by local buses. If rail services are disrupted, replacement services provide smooth connections to nearby destinations such as Staines and Windsor. Tickets at Lye station are managed predominantly through the use of ticket machines, as there is no traditional ticket office on site. It’s best to purchase tickets online and collect them conveniently at a ticket machine. However, note that the ticket machines are not accessible. Help points and staff assistance are available should you need guidance during weekdays from early morning until late evening, and on a more limited schedule over weekends. While the station is accredited by the Secure Station Scheme, certain amenities such as public toilets or refreshment facilities are not available at Lye station. Those planning to cycle can find stands for securing their bikes, although there is no sheltered storage.
For passengers requiring additional accessibility features, Lye station is partially equipped with step-free access to platforms, categorized under the B1 classification, which may involve longer or steeper ramps. However, passengers should be aware that a comprehensive network of accessible ticket machines and toilets is lacking. Assistance for boarding trains can be sought from the attentive conductors on site, ensuring smooth travel for travelers with mobility needs.
Transport links at Lye Train Station are quite accommodating. Should rail services be disrupted, replacement options are available on Dudley Road, a short walk from Station Drive. Local taxi services such as Four Star and A to B offer reliable transport, and you can contact them at 01384 894344 and 01384 353535, respectively.
